about item
  • Quartz movement Analog: 3 hands (hour, minute, second)
  • Water-resistant to 50 Meters / 165 Feet / 5 ATM
  • Case / bezel: Ion plated
  • Large, easy-to-read Arabic numerals
  • Approx. battery life: 3 years on SR626SW

This is a great watch for the price. It's got a great retro look, but it's also quite classy. I really dislike tiny women's watches, so I've often had to buy men's watches instead, but it's hard to find one that doesn't look comically large on my wrist. This watch is the perfect size -- neither too tiny nor too large. I also love that is has a date window, which can be difficult to find on a ladies' watch. The only drawback is the band. It looks fine, but it feels a bit cheap. I knew from reading the description that it was pigskin, so it wasn't a surprise. But I knew the watch would look much better with a new band so I bought a fullgrain leather replacement. (Note: The description says the band is 18mm. This is wrong. The band is 16mm.) The watch looks fantastic now. Even with the added expense, it looks like it cost twice as much. I love this watch so much, I bought one in the other color with the white dial and brown band as well.

I had another Casio watch that lasted at least 4 or 5 years. It was great. I exposed it to high amounts of heat on a regular basis and it did great. I wore it 24/7. It was the Illuminator Chrono Alarm watch. It had a canvas band that was destroyed, smelled awful, and just recently the illuminating feature died.And the search to find the perfect watch began. It had to be: Black, classy, have the date feature, and be able to illuminate the date in the dark. This fit the bill and I was so excited. So far, everything looks great. I haven't been able to test the illuminating capabilities yet. It was easy to set the time. I usually have to ask either a brother or a boyfriend to set my watch. Since this was analog, it was very easy to do. I was a little concerned because I have a small wrist and I don't like things to be loose on my wrist. On my other watch I had it set to the tightest setting and it was a little loose ( I think it may have been a mens watch, though). This one I don't even have it on the tightest and it is very comfortable. I still have another 3 notches to make it tighter.I will say the date feature isn't the easiest to read if you just look fast. I have 20/20 vision and the print is just a little small. It's not a big deal. The other numbers are very easy to read. The cut of the leather isn't the highest quality. It does have a nice leather smell. But you can tell at the edges they didn't finish them off as nicely as it could have been. I'm sure with time it'll smooth out and look nice. It's not a raw edge though, the finished the edge with some type of paint or rubber, which is nice.Overall, I love it. The style is excellent. I hope the face doesn't scratch.
